Bipasha Basu turns 44, check out husband Karan Singh Grover's sweet message for her

| @indiablooms | Jan 07, 2023, at 07:58 pm

Mumbai: Bollywood beauty Bipasha Basu turned 44 on Saturday as her husband Karan wished her with a special note on Instagram.

It is a sizzling image that Karan added with his post that drew the attention of their fans.

In his sweet post penned down by him for Bipasha, Karan wrote: " Wish you a very very very happy birthday my love! @bipashabasuMay every moment of your life be filled with joy, may your light shine brighter with each passing day, may all your dreams come true.It’s absolutely the best day of the year! Love you more than I can sayHappy happy happy birthday my sweet baby love! You are my everything!"

The message quickly earned a reaction from the birthday girl herself who wrote in the comment section: " You are my life’s biggest gift and now our baby girl Devi Thank you for loving me so much."

Karan Singh Grover married actress Bipasha Basu on 30 April 2016.

They welcomed their first baby girl last year.
